Waldorf Astoria is looking for a Group and Transient Rooms Coordinator to join the team at this property. Located in one of Atlanta's most prestigious neighborhoods, this 42-story tower has over 200 rooms (127 guest rooms plus residences), over 10,000 square feet of meeting space, and 3 food and beverage outlets (the 3-meal restaurant, bar, and in-room dining).
What will I be doing?- Handle group and transient reservations generated from Sales and Catering Managers, and support leisure, business travel, and front desk reservations.
- Facilitate OnQ input and cross-reference with Delphi data; maintain group blocks and prepare various reports.
- Attend pre-convention meetings and meet with group planners; perform tasks to the highest standards listed below.
- Check for and review group GRO alerts; review No Show report for group cancellations.
- Monitor and take lead on ATL Res emails and handle reservation requests.
- Add credit card authorizations to master for deposits; prepare amenity requests; support groups in-house.
- Send out cutoff date reminders; complete customer callbacks/personal line; create/update Master for new rate plans in OnQ (Transient, BT, Consortia and Group).
- Check GRC daily against pick up; review Group invoice for accuracy post invoice.
- Enter Group rooming lists; perform Fastpay reconciliation; send clients rooming list with confirmation numbers.
- Calculate and monitor Group attrition and advise clients of status and options; build Group blocks in R&I; complete pick-up reports.
- Process check requests and commission inquiries; review and attend Resume & Group activities; update GPU from team call; submit info for Resume Packet distribution; double-check GRC before meeting.
- Process Group/commission packets and reports; award Event Planner points; update Points Log; conduct Group audits for housing bureaus as needed.
- Serve as backup to the Sales & Event Coordinator and perform other duties as required by leadership.
- Minimum one year in Full-Service Front Desk or Reservations hotel experience.
- Strong verbal and written communication skills; proficient computer literacy (Microsoft Office, Excel, PowerPoint).
- Excellent typing and organizational skills; high degree of confidentiality; well-organized and detail-oriented.
- Ability to work without supervision and coordinate multiple tasks; high level of interaction with all staff; professional demeanor at all times.
- Willingness and ability to learn and apply new systems; proficiency in Rates & Inventory systems (OnQ Rates & Inventory, Delphi.fdc, GRO).
